What is the purpose of a commitment for title insurance?

ATo guarantee the appraised value of the property
BTo outline the conditions under which the title company will issue a title insurance policy, including exceptions✓ Correct
CTo confirm the property tax assessment
DTo provide a legal description of the property

Explanation

A title insurance commitment (preliminary commitment) identifies the insured parties, coverage amounts, conditions and stipulations, and all exceptions (liens, easements, encumbrances) that will appear in the final policy. Buyers review it before closing.
